THE LOCK-IN PROBLEM

Proprietary hardware is a decision you keep paying for.

Appliance storage bundles the software you want with metal you did not choose, at a price you cannot see. The cost is not only the mark-up. It is the lead times, the coupled lifecycles, and the fact that every expansion has exactly one supplier.

THE MARK-UP
You pay a storage premium on general-purpose parts
An appliance bundles the software you want with servers and drives you did not select, priced as one opaque number. The components underneath are the same ones on the open market.
VDURA: Open hardware at your buying power, with zero mark-up applied by VDURA.
COUPLED LIFECYCLES
The software refresh waits on the hardware refresh
When features arrive only with the next generation of controller, your upgrade cadence is set by a vendor roadmap rather than by what your cluster needs.
VDURA: Software upgrades independently of the hardware lifecycle. New capability lands on the servers you already own, and refreshes happen when the economics say so. Features arrive in software, not new boxes.
WHY IT IS POSSIBLE

Commodity hardware, by design.

Most systems need special hardware because they push availability down into the box. HYDRA is shared-nothing, so availability is a property of the cluster. That single decision is what makes standard parts sufficient.

SHARED NOTHING
Availability comes from the cluster
Every node owns its own data and metadata, so there is no controller pair to buy in matched, failover-capable sets.
SOFTWARE EC
Protection runs in software
Client-side dual-parity (n+2) erasure coding runs across nodes. Firmware-based RAID controllers and their write-hole edge cases are simply absent.
SINGLE PORT
Standard drives are sufficient
Failover is not a drive-level concern, so single-port NVMe works — removing one of the largest hidden premiums in enterprise storage.
MIXED FLEET
Any media, one namespace
NVMe flash and SATA HDD live in a single global namespace, so you ride both cost curves independently as prices move. Buy only the resource that is short.

CERTIFIED COMPONENTS
Server platforms AIC, Dell, Supermicro
Node form factor 1U/2U, minimum config 6U
Flash Single-port U.2 NVMe, TLC or QLC
Capacity media SATA HDD, CMR, SMR, or HAMR
NVMe vendors Phison, Kioxia, Solidigm
HDD vendors Western Digital, Seagate
Networking vendors AMD, NVIDIA, Broadcom
Networking InfiniBand NDR/NDR200, 400/200/100 GbE
Scale 6 nodes to thousands
Proprietary components None
